网站首页 atomicboolean和boolean的区别
-
并发编程:并发操作原子类Atomic以及CAS的ABA问题
本文基于JDK1.8...
2024-08-25 nanyue 技术文章 10 ℃ -
JAVA包含哪些原子类?他们的原理是什么呢?
JAVA作为一种广泛应用的编程语言,其提供的原子类在多线程编程中起到了至关重要的作用。原子类能够确保在多线程环境下对共享变量的操作是线程安全的,避免了数据竞争和并发访问的问题。接下来,我们将深入探讨JAVA中包含的原子类以及它们的原理。首先...
2024-08-25 nanyue 技术文章 6 ℃ -
还不懂 Java 中的多线程?(java多线程有几种实现方法实战)
作者|纳达丶无忌原文|jianshu.com/p/40d4c7aebd66前言...
2024-08-25 nanyue 技术文章 9 ℃ -
多线程-004-同步容器与并发容器,原子类
Java中的容器主要可以分为四个大类,分别是List、Map、Set和Queue(都是接口)。线程不安全:ArrayList、HashMap,HashSet。...
2024-08-25 nanyue 技术文章 7 ℃ -
java中的多线程你只要看这一篇就够了
引如果对什么是线程、什么是进程仍存有疑惑,请先Google之,因为这两个概念不在本文的范围之内。用多线程只有一个目的,那就是更好的利用cpu的资源,因为所有的多线程代码都可以用单线程来实现。说这个话其实只有一半对,因为反应“多角色”的程序代...
2024-08-25 nanyue 技术文章 9 ℃ -
超级详细Java中的多线程详解(超级详细java中的多线程详解是什么)
如果对什么是线程、什么是进程仍存有疑惑,请先Google之,因为这两个概念不在本文的范围之内。用多线程只有一个目的,那就是更好的利用cpu的资源,因为所有的多线程代码都可以用单线程来实现。说这个话其实只有一半对,因为反应“多角色”的程序代码...
2024-08-25 nanyue 技术文章 9 ℃ -
“全栈2019”Java原子操作第八章:AtomicReference介绍与使用
难度初级学习时间30分钟适合人群零基础开发语言Java...
2024-08-25 nanyue 技术文章 7 ℃ -
「Java线程」线程安全三元素:原子性、可见性、有序性
定义首先大家需要思考一下何为线程安全性呢???《Java并发编程实战》书中给出定义:当多个线程访问某个类时,不管运行时环境采用何种调度方式或者这些线程将如何交替执行,并且在调用代码中不需要任何额外的同步,这个类都能表现出正确的行为,那么这个...
2024-08-25 nanyue 技术文章 7 ℃ -
从InterruptedException深入理解AtomicReference的方方面面
前言...
2024-08-25 nanyue 技术文章 6 ℃ -
快速理解Java并发编程之无锁CAS与Unsafe类
一、简介众所周知并发的典型代表是synchronized关键字的使用。它通过对共享资源上锁来保证线程安全。更确切的说synchronized是悲观锁。而java还提供了一种无锁并发机制来保证线程的安全,这就是著名的CAS(CompareA...
2024-08-25 nanyue 技术文章 6 ℃
- 1506℃桌面软件开发新体验!用 Blazor Hybrid 打造简洁高效的视频处理工具
- 483℃MySQL service启动脚本浅析(r12笔记第59天)
- 470℃Dify工具使用全场景:dify-sandbox沙盒的原理(源码篇·第2期)
- 461℃启用MySQL查询缓存(mysql8.0查询缓存)
- 458℃服务器异常重启,导致mysql启动失败,问题解决过程记录
- 442℃「赵强老师」MySQL的闪回(赵强iso是哪个大学毕业的)
- 420℃mysql服务怎么启动和关闭?(mysql服务怎么启动和关闭)
- 416℃MySQL server PID file could not be found!失败
- 控制面板
- 网站分类
- 最新留言
-